8.112.105    UNCONDITIONAL CONVEYANCE

(1) It is preferred that all acquisitions are conveyed, sold, granted or devised unconditionally to the commission. The commission may, nonetheless, in its discretion, decide to make an acquisition which has reasonable conditions.

History: 22-3-1003, MCA; IMP, 22-3-1003, MCA; NEW, 2000 MAR p. 966, Eff. 4/14/00; TRANS, from Dept. of Education, 2008 MAR p. 492, Eff. 3/14/08.
